Come and stretch out the week with music and movement!

Chair exercise group volunteers bring the energy of a fitness workout but guide people with gentle movements, as participants are sitting comfortably in a chair. Perhaps you have a background in fitness, dance, yoga, physio, Pilates or just love to dance and you'd like to lead a small group. You'll be helping older residents in care to maintain their mobility as well as their healthy wellbeing - and have fun!
